Three quarters of vehicles dangerously loaded
Officials from the Health and Safety Executive (HSE) and the vehicle Operator Services Agency (VOSA) in a joint effort stopped 40 vehicles during three days of checks in Wrexham, Birmingham and Humberside. Although the majority needed remedial action to make the load safe for onward travel and unloading, in most cases drivers were able to solve the problem within minutes. Further checks are now planned. During the last three years, 14 people have been killed and more than 2,00 people have been injured by cargo falling from vehicles when they are being loaded or unloaded. Badly secured loads pose a number of risks, including; shedding loads in transit, endangering other road users and causing traffic disruption, vehicles overturning when they become unstable following a load shifting in transit, loads moving inside the vehicle during transit which then fall off at the point of delivery, with potential to cause injury, workers climbing onto trailers to deal with a load that has shifted in transit then falling because they have a precarious foot hold, or being struck by parts of the load or suffering manual handling injuries when they try to unload the vehicle and damage to goods being carried.
